Effect of plate aspect ratio and corrugation depth in plate heat exchangers on heat transfer

2011-06-15View Original

Thread Content

Those who often use plate heat exchangers know that the length-to-width ratio and the corrugation depth of the plates have a significant impact on the operating conditions. For example, in hot air conditioning and geothermal heating systems, a smaller length-to-width ratio is required, with a corrugation depth of 3.5–4.0 being appropriate; whereas for cold air conditioning systems, a larger length-to-width ratio is needed, with a corrugation depth of 2.0–2.5 being suitable.
